The Philadelphia International Unity Cup (unitycup.phila.gov) is a neighborhood-based soccer tournament hosted by the City of Philadelphia. Modeled after the FIFA World Cup with each team representing a particular country, the program utilizes the universal language of sport to unify communities and to showcase Philadelphia’s rich cultural diversity. In 2023, 48 men’s teams and, for the first time, 8 women’s teams played matches across the city throughout August and September. In championship competitions Ireland outlasted Liberia for the men’s crown and USA defeated Mexico in the women’s final. Given the international spirit of this program and the fact that many member countries are represented, CCAP has again provided financial support to the Unity Cup.

Philly Shipyard Christens First NSMV Vessel for MARAD

Philly Shipyard, Inc. (PSI) hosted a Christening Ceremony to celebrate the launching of the “Empire State”, the first of five National Security Multi-Mission Vessels to be constructed in Philadelphia for the U.S. Maritime Administration (MARAD). NSMV is a training vessel for the U.S. marine academies and is also equipped to provide humanitarian relief in areas affected by national disasters. Philadelphia’s NSMV program will eventually cost $1.5 billion and is employing 1600 workers at the Navy Yard. PSI is an Associate Member of the Consular Corps Association of Philadelphia.

Jamaica Shines in 127th Penn Relays

The Penn Relays is the oldest and largest track and field competition in the United States, hosted annually since 1895 by the University of Pennsylvania at Franklin Field in Philadelphia. Top high school, collegiate and professional athletes compete in this three day event which attracts over 100,000 spectators.
While international participation has grown over the years, only Jamaica has demonstrated individual and team performances which challenge the U.S. athletes at all levels. Since 1964, Jamaica’s success on the track has also transformed the Penn Relays itself into a wonderful promotion of Brand Jamaica – a festival which attracts a third of total attendees, visiting government officials, sponsors and trade missions. Christopher Chaplin, Honorary Consul of Jamaica and CCAP President, provided important coordination and local leadership that assured similar success in 2023.
